Rate and Write a Review For a music club that is essentially a corporate chain with locations scattered across the United States, the New Orleans House of Blues is not a bad place to see a show. The sound and sightlines are quite impressive. The upside: drinks are readily accessible from four different bars. The club books high-quality and in-demand acts from a wide array of musical genres -- bands such as the Neville Brothers, Gov't Mule, Karl Denson, Snoop Dogg and Slayer regularly perform at the House of Blues when they come through town. The club distinguishes itself from other venues with little touches, such as the bathroom attendants and the religion-based artwork over the stage. The House of Blues exists as both a live music venue and a dance club by hosting special events such as: Latino Night, Service Industry Night and Hip-Hop Night. The HOB chain prides itself on presenting a vaguely authentic recreation of classic Southern dining in its restaurants, so perhaps it's not too surprising that the French Quarter version doesn't embarrass itself in one of the world's finest dining districts. It's not authentic Creole, exactly, but you can catch dinner or lunch here while enjoying the music and not feel like you're missing out. It's no coincidence that the most popular meal here is musical -- Sunday's excellent Gospel Brunch.
